Product Notes

Taittinger Brut Réserve is a prestigious champagne that embodies the essence of sophistication and elegance. Made from a blend of Chardonnay, Pinot Noir, and Pinot Meunier grapes, this exquisite wine displays a pale golden color with fine bubbles that dance gracefully in the glass. The nose is delicate and floral, with hints of citrus, ripe pear, and brioche. On the palate, it is fresh and vibrant, offering flavors of green apple, white peach, and toasted almonds. The finish is long and luxurious, leaving a lingering impression of finesse and refinement. About the Winery

Taittinger is one of the most reputed wine names in the world. The Taittinger family has been producing Champagne ever since 1734 from its Champagne House located in Reims. Emmanuel Tattinger, the founder of this brand, is not only a popular and affluent winemaker in France, but also an astute businessman who owns a few companies and hotels.
